The Core Gameplay Loop: A Test of Reflexes

At its heart, the gameplay of this style of game revolves around quick reactions and careful observation. Players control a chicken, utilizing simple tap or click controls to maneuver it forward across a constant stream of vehicles. The speed and frequency of the traffic gradually increase, demanding greater precision and anticipation from the player. As the chicken successfully crosses lanes, the player accumulates points, creating a rewarding feedback mechanism that encourages continued play. Failure, however, means a swift and abrupt end, adding a layer of tension to each attempt.

The apparent simplicity masks a surprisingly nuanced skill ceiling. Mastering the game involves not only reacting to immediate dangers but also predicting traffic patterns and timing movements to maximize efficiency and minimize risk. Furthermore, many variations introduce power-ups, cosmetic customization and other features, keeping the experience fresh and appealing. Using these additions, the engaging and addictive nature of the gameplay is further improved.

Power-Ups and Strategic Advantages

Many iterations incorporate power-ups to add another layer of strategic depth. These can range from temporary speed boosts, allowing the chicken to quickly dash across lanes, to shields that absorb a single hit from an oncoming vehicle. Effective use of these power-ups is crucial for navigating especially challenging sections and achieving high scores. Knowing when to deploy a power-up – whether to preemptively avoid a cluster of cars or to recover from a near miss – is a key element of advanced gameplay. Successfully implementing these boosts and shields dramatically increases the high scores.

Successfully incorporating power-ups requires players to balance risk and reward. Using a limited resource strategically can be far more effective than indiscriminately deploying it. The scarcity of these items adds a layer of calculated decision-making to the sheer reflex-based challenge and adds depth to what would otherwise be a very simple experience.

Progression and Customization

To maintain long-term engagement, many variations introduce some form of progression and customization. This could involve unlocking new skins for the chicken, granting access to different game modes, or implementing a leveling system that rewards consistent play. Customization options allow players to express their individuality and add a personal touch to their gaming experience. A sense of progression provides an incentive to continue playing and strive for higher scores.

The effective implementation of progression systems is crucial; it must be balanced to provide a sense of achievement without becoming overly grindy or frustrating. Rewarding players with meaningful unlocks and cosmetic upgrades can significantly enhance their investment in the game and encourage them to keep coming back for more.

Variations and Themes

While the core concept remains largely consistent, numerous variations and themes have emerged, adding a diverse range of experiences within the broader genre. Some games feature different animals, such as frogs or ducks, replacing the chicken, while others introduce environmental hazards beyond traffic, like moving obstacles or changing weather conditions. These iterations offer a freshness and adaptability to the existing formula. The breadth of these factors creates a varied and exciting world of opportunities.

This adaptability expands the appeal to different demographics. Developers frequently tailor the visual aesthetics and challenges to align with specific themes or licensed properties, attracting a broader audience based on their existing interests. The sheer creativity inherent in the concept leads to a constant stream of innovative variations, ensuring a steady flow of engaging content for players.
